Chaperone

Job Summary
  • Supervises and assists students in transit or crossing streets.
  • Moves or assists in moving students whose mobility is impaired by their special needs.
  • Facilitates the loading and unloading process, including assisting with wheelchair students and securing wheelchairs.
  • Assist students into car seats and booster seats, buckling seatbelts as needed.
  • Monitors and assists students to ensure comfort, safety and orderly conduct on bus.
  • Demonstrates and role models positive, safe and responsible behavior.
Chaperone

Physical Requirements
  • Climbing on and off bus, bending and squatting to assist students as needed, sitting for extended periods.
  • Capable of assisting, moving or dragging students in case of an emergency (ranging in weight from small child to full adult).
  • Exposure to elements, road dust, occasional fuel and exhaust fumes.

District 196 is a Minnesota public school district of choice, serving more than 29,000 students and 160,000 residents in the cities of Rosemount, Apple Valley, Eagan, Burnsville, Coates, Empire, Inver Grove Heights and Lakeville, and Vermillion Township. District 196 is the third largest school district in Minnesota and among the largest employers in Dakota County, with more than 4,000 full- and part-time employees.

District 196 has been named to Forbes  list of America s Best-in-State Employers multiple times based on a survey asking employees to rate their employers and how likely they would be to recommend them to others.

District 196 has 20 elementary schools (grades K-5); six middle schools (grades 6-8); four high schools (grades 9-12); an optional School of Environmental Studies for juniors and seniors; an Area Learning Center high school program; a K-12 special education school, and a special education program serving young adults ages 18-22. The district also operates three learning centers that provide early childhood and Adult Basic Education services, and offers extensive community education programs and classes for learners of all ages.
